I like the scope of what you are attempting by recreating Hogwarts. The HP series was extremely popular so when you are finished, I'm sure your map will get a lot of attention. Have you played the EA games? Are they any good? I would think it would be important that the world you create should be better or add something to what EA has already done.

The ghost detector concept is cool but I don't really see something like that in that world. HP is more about magic and spells and less about gadgets and devices. If you could model a map the player holds that shows footsteps approaching instead of the gadget with lights, that would be much more in the spirit of Harry Potter. The gadget in the vid reminds me of something you might see in Ghostbusters (who also released game not too long ago).

Anyways, keep at it. And start texturing, lighting and detailing. It seems that this community gets the most worked up over striking scenes and less about the plain geometry.

Hi, I am currently planning to work together with someone from another forum. He made the basic exterior shape, but to be honest, that shape isn't well how to put it... big enough XD.

There is a really slow progress with this project currently, cuz I took the worst moment to start with this XD, lots of ther school projects :(.


Our main idea about the castle: To create detailed models as exterior, and put them on the basic brush structure. This will allow us to use lots of detail, while not screwing up the lighting :P. Also, models can also be used for interior if really detailed.
